The First All Wheel Drive: E30 ix

In the late 1980s, BMW introduced its first all wheel drive system in the E30 model lineup. The E30 ix, as it was known, was a classic Bavarian beauty that combined the sporty performance of a BMW with the added stability and traction of AWD. This pioneering model paved the way for future AWD systems in BMW vehicles.

The E30 ix featured a sophisticated AWD system that distributed power between the front and rear wheels, ensuring optimal traction in all driving conditions. This innovative system was a game-changer for BMW enthusiasts who wanted the performance of a rear-wheel drive BMW with the added confidence and stability of all wheel drive.

With the success of the E30 ix, BMW realized the potential of all wheel drive and decided to further refine and improve its AWD technology.

The Introduction of X Drive

Building upon the success of the E30 ix, BMW introduced the X Drive system in the early 2000s. X Drive took BMW's AWD technology to the next level, offering enhanced performance and handling in various driving conditions.

Initially available in the BMW E46 325xi and 330xi models, X Drive quickly became a popular choice among BMW enthusiasts. The advanced X Drive system combined the benefits of all wheel drive with BMW's renowned sporty driving dynamics, giving drivers the best of both worlds.

One of the key advantages of X Drive is its ability to continuously distribute power between the front and rear axles, based on the current driving conditions. This dynamic power distribution ensures optimal traction and stability, giving drivers confidence in any situation.

Additionally, X Drive is seamlessly integrated with other BMW performance systems, such as Dynamic Stability Control (DSC) and Dynamic Traction Control (DTC). This integration allows for precise control and handling, even in challenging driving scenarios.

Over the years, BMW has further refined the X Drive system, incorporating advanced technologies and features to enhance its performance and efficiency. Today, you can find X Drive in various BMW models across the lineup, including sedans, SUVs, and even high-performance sports cars.

The Benefits of X Drive

So, what sets X Drive apart from traditional AWD systems? One of the key advantages of X Drive is its ability to adapt to changing road conditions and optimize power distribution accordingly. Whether you're driving on wet roads, snowy terrain, or even tackling off-road adventures, X Drive ensures that power is sent to the wheels with the most traction, keeping you in control.

Furthermore, X Drive offers enhanced stability and cornering performance. By continuously monitoring driving dynamics and adjusting power distribution, X Drive enables precise handling and balanced weight distribution, resulting in a more engaging and enjoyable driving experience.

Another notable benefit of X Drive is its seamless integration with BMW's other advanced safety features. With X Drive, you can take advantage of features like ABS (Anti-lock Braking System), ESC (Electronic Stability Control), and advanced braking systems, which work in harmony to optimize safety and performance.
